Title: Status and future directions for advanced accelerator research - conventional and non-conventional collider concepts

Abstract

The relationship between advanced accelerator research and future directions for particle physics is discussed. Comments are made about accelerator research trends in hadron colliders, muon colliders, and e{sup +}3{sup {minus}} linear colliders.
